Best I know so far is to buy Rams from Siege master during Season when prices up:
then you can get 3-4 silvers for 6 badges.
or 30-40 for 60
or 3-4 gold for every 600 badges.

I took it a step further one time:
superior flame ram currently costs 14s50c
normal flame ram currently sells for 1s50c (1.27 after tax)
so it takes 11.4 normal to get one superior
11.4 × 6 = 68.5 badges to buy superior flame ram

all of the promotions are currently profitable (if you buy normal siege using buy orders and sell superior with sell listings), but they only give about 7-10s/SP in profit. omega golem is currently the highest profit at 44s each (14s/SP)
